a.      What is Copyright Penalty?

It is a legal term referring to the uniqueness of another author’s work.  It is a civil infringement. Civil torts about seeking restitution, so you pay back according to the damages you caused.

To understand the concept more easily keep in mind that you cannot make a sequel of Harry Potter or Games of Thorns because the authors have copyright.

A copyright owner owns exclusive bundle of rights for his works such as to reproduce, distribute copies, perform, display, and prepare derivative works.  A derivative work is a transformation of the original such as translation of a book from one language into another.

Using a copyrighted work without the permission is an infringement of these rights. Likewise, the owner could bring the case to the federal court.

b.     Remedies of copyright Penalty

Remedies of copyright infringement include:

  • Impoundment and destruction of infringing material
  • Injunctive relief
  • Attorney’s fees
  • Actual damages or statutory damages

e.       Factors to Determine If Using Copyright is Fair or Not

A court determines 4 factors to determine if using a copyright is a fair use or not:

a.      The Purpose and Character of Using Copyright

Educational purpose of using copyright weighs in favor of fair use while commercial use does not.

b.     The Nature of the Copyrighted Work

Using portions of a factual work like a biography or article is more likely to be excused as fair than copying fictional works.

c.      The Amount of the Work Used

The less you use the more likely it will be fair use.

d.     The Potential Market for the Work

Fair use is less likely if the use deprives the copyright owner of income or a market.

Courts have broad discretion in finding fair use that makes it difficult to predict the outcome of a fair use defense.

Keep in view that citations and disclaimers to the copyright owner will not cure an infringement. So, you need to be cautious when relying on fair use and you may consult your attorney before doing so.
